Pebble Beach Golf Course

Pebble Beach, Pebble Beach

Considered California’s most ideal golf destination, Pebble Beach is a dream come true. Pebble Beach’s dramatic coastline offers an astounding view and golfers around the world regard it as America’s finest public course.

Pebble Beach has played host to many top past tournaments, including 5 U.S. Open Championships.

The nearby city of Monterey offers world-famous, compelling attractions. Explore the colorful Fisherman’s Wharf, historic Cannery Row and the popular Monterey Bay Aquarium.

Winter offers discounted prices since the busiest months fall between April and November. Year-round resorts include The Lodge at Pebble Beach, The Inn at Spanish Bay and Casa Palmero.

Torrey Pines South Course

Torrey Pines (South), La Jolla

Bask in the splendor of the spectacular, world-renowned golf course at Torrey Pines. Located north of downtown San Diego, the course offers views of golden sandstone formations and rare Torrey Pine trees.

Torrey Pines is also the site of the 2008 U.S. Open Championship. Tiger Woods defeated Rocco Mediate in 90 grueling holes of exciting golf.

If you’re a single handicapper, the South Course is perfect for you. Enjoy its open fairways, large landing areas and well-manicured greens.

La Quinta Resort

La Quinta Resort (Mountain), La Quinta

You won’t care what your scorecard says. Soak in the sunshine and spectacular mountain views at the La Quinta Resort.

The mountain course has hosted many famed golf tournaments. Play where Jack Nicklaus, Lee Trevino and David Duval have tested their skills and made their marks.

La Quinta is great as a romantic weekend or as a treat for your family. It has deep blue pools, gorgeous manicured lawns, bright flower beds and quaint shops.
